The Facts:
Anderson will start next Sunday's game against the Dallas Cowboys, a source told ESPN.com's James Walker Sunday night. "Barring any unforeseen event, [Anderson] is going to play," the source said.

Fantasy Football Diehards Line:
Anderson has been sidelined since Aug. 18 with a mild concussion. Although not 100-percent committed, Browns general manager Phil Savage also hinted to reporters over the weekend that Anderson should be ready. "The expectation is 'DA' will be back and ready to go," Savage said. ... As Walker suggests, Anderson will be one of the most watched quarterbacks in 2008 coming off a surprise Pro Bowl season. He threw for 3,787 yards, 29 touchdowns and 19 interceptions while going 10-5 as a starter for the Browns last season.
